Mechanisms of long-lasting hyperpolarizations underlying slow sleep oscillations in cat corticothalamic networks.
1. To explore the nature of the long-lasting hyperpolarizations that characterize slow oscillations in corticothalamic circuits in vivo, intracellular recordings were obtained under ketamine-xylazine anaesthesia from cortical (Cx) cells of the cat precruciate motor cortex, thalamic reticular (RE) ce...
